Enhancing Pediatric Medical Training With Simulation Manikins

pediatric simulation manikins, also known as pediatric patient simulators, are advanced technological devices used in medical training to simulate real-life scenarios involving pediatric patients. These lifelike manikins are equipped with various features that replicate the physiology and anatomy of a child, providing healthcare professionals with a valuable tool for practicing and refining their skills in a safe and controlled environment. The use of pediatric simulation manikins has completely revolutionized the way medical education and training are conducted, offering a realistic and immersive learning experience that helps improve patient outcomes.

One of the key benefits of using pediatric simulation manikins in medical training is the ability to recreate a wide range of clinical scenarios involving pediatric patients. These manikins can be programmed to exhibit symptoms of common childhood illnesses, such as asthma, pneumonia, or sepsis, allowing healthcare providers to practice diagnosing and treating these conditions in a realistic setting. By experiencing these scenarios first-hand, medical students, residents, and practicing physicians can enhance their clinical skills and decision-making abilities, ultimately leading to improved patient care.

pediatric simulation manikins also offer a safe and controlled environment for healthcare professionals to practice critical procedures and interventions without putting real patients at risk. For example, trainees can practice placing intravenous catheters, performing tracheal intubations, or administering medications on a pediatric simulation manikin before performing these tasks on actual patients. This hands-on training helps build confidence and proficiency in healthcare providers, ensuring that they are well-prepared to handle pediatric emergencies and complex medical situations.

Furthermore, pediatric simulation manikins are equipped with advanced technology that allows for the monitoring and recording of various physiological parameters. These manikins can simulate changes in heart rate, blood pressure, respiratory rate, and other vital signs in real-time, providing immediate feedback to participants during simulations. By analyzing these data points, healthcare providers can identify areas for improvement, refine their clinical skills, and enhance their overall performance in managing pediatric patients. This valuable feedback loop helps healthcare professionals learn from their mistakes and continuously strive for excellence in patient care.
